Overview

As a Kitchen Assistant at Amberley Hall Care Home, you will be responsible for supporting the Head Chef to provide a high-quality food service within the home, ensuring that high standards are achieved to meet the needs of the residents.

About The Role

Reporting to the Head Chef, the Kitchen Assistant will work to ensure the catering services and dining experiences are of the highest standard and quality for our residents – this includes the maintenance of public areas, such as the café area, and providing refreshments for our residents and their guests.

Salary

£12.21 per hour.

Shift Pattern

25.75 hours per week, worked on a rota basis from Monday to Sunday.

Home Location

Baldock Drive, King\\\’s Lynn, England, PE30 3DQ.

Key Duties & Responsibilities

  • Support the Head Chef to ensure the catering services and residential dining experience is of the highest standard and quality.
  • Assist the Head Chef with meal service to the residents, ensuring the meals cater for the resident’s dietary requirements and the areas are clean and stocked appropriately.
  • To actively engage with residents in conversation and meaningful occupation related to their lifestyle choices at a level and pace that values the individual and respects their dignity and communication differences.
  • Ensure Health & Safety within the services team, residents and visitors meet the requirements of the Food Safety Manual and Health and Safety Manual.

Training, Skills & Experience Required

  • Experience of working within a kitchen environment, or have a catering background, ideally within a care environment but this is not essential.
  • NVQ Level 2 in Food Hygiene is desirable.
  • Reliable with excellent communication skills, and high attention to detail.
  • Computer literate, with the ability to use basic Microsoft Office applications.

About Athena

Athena Care Homes are a family run business with seven homes across East Anglia. We have care homes in Peterborough, Cambridgeshire, Kings Lynn (West Norfolk) & Ipswich (Suffolk).

We want to be the first choice for high quality residential, nursing and dementia care, leaving a positive legacy within our communities.

Our care homes are managed by amazing and passionate people, including strong leadership by our home managers with dedicated care, clinical, hospitality and activities teams to provide exceptional care and experience, achieving brilliant outcomes for people in our care.
